Abstract

This study aims to determine how effective the implementation of the Job Training program is in order to reduce the unemployment rate in Bulukumba Regency, supporting and inhibiting factors for program implementation and efforts to overcome these obstacles. The research method used by the author in this study is a qualitative research method with an inductive type of descriptive writing. While the data collection techniques carried out are interviews, observation and documentation. Meanwhile, data analysis techniques are carried out by reducing data, presenting data, and drawing conclusions. The results of this study show that the program to provide training for workers in Bulukumba Regency which has been run since 2016 at the Bulukumba Regency Job Training Center has been carried out well but has not been fully effective.
